Detailed Description

template<class LimiterFunc>
class Foam::SFCDLimiter< LimiterFunc >

Class with limiter function which returns the limiter for the SFCD differencing scheme based on phict obtained from the LimiterFunc class.

Used in conjunction with the template class LimitedScheme.
